次の方法で共有


IGossipChannel インターフェイス

定義

ゴシップ チャネルのインターフェイス。

ゴシップ チャネルは、マルチクラスター データ (構成、ゲートウェイ) を格納し、gossip スタイルの通信を使用してサイロとこのデータを交換し、2 つの異なる方法 (発行または同期) を提供します。

public interface IGossipChannel
type IGossipChannel = interface
Public Interface IGossipChannel

プロパティ

Name

チャネルの名前。

メソッド

Initialize(Guid, String)

指定された構成でチャネルを初期化します。

Initialize(String, String)

指定された構成でチャネルを初期化します。

Publish(IMultiClusterGossipData)

一方向の小規模なゴシップ。 チャネル内の少量のデータ (マルチクラスター構成、単一ゲートウェイの状態など) を更新するために使用されます。 渡されたデータは、既に格納されているデータよりも新しい場合にのみ格納されます。

Publish(MultiClusterData)

一方向の小規模なゴシップ。 チャネル内の少量のデータ (マルチクラスター構成、単一ゲートウェイの状態など) を更新するために使用されます。 渡されたデータは、既に格納されているデータよりも新しい場合にのみ格納されます。

Synchronize(IMultiClusterGossipData)

双方向の一括ゴシップ。

  • 格納された情報よりも新しい渡された情報が格納されます。
  • 渡された情報よりも新しい格納された情報が返されます。
Synchronize(MultiClusterData)

双方向の一括ゴシップ。

  • 格納された情報よりも新しい渡された情報が格納されます。
  • 渡された情報よりも新しい格納された情報が返されます。

適用対象